Hands to Heaven




Hands to Heaven
BY:Breathe©

A man stood quietly in the rain. It didn’t really
seem to bother him. In fact, he didn’t seem to
notice that it was raining, at all. He seemed lost in
thought.
It had been four years since he had held her.
~
JC Chasez stood quietly beside her. He couldn’t see
her, but he knew she was there. He let a
tear roll slowly down his cheek. He thought he could
hear music playing from somewhere, but
didn’t know where. It sounded like the song that was
playing on their last night together.

“As I watch you move, across the moonlit room
There's so much tenderness in your loving
Tomorrow I must leave, the dawn knows no reprieve”

JC had been packing his bags for another tour with ‘N
Sync. Tallia, his girlfriend of two
years, and soon to be wife, had to stay behind. She
would be joining him on tour in a few months.

“God give me strength when I am leaving...
So raise your hands to heaven and pray
That we'll be back together someday
Tonight, I need your sweet caress
Hold me in the darkness
Tonight, you calm my restlessness
You relieve my sadness”
“As we move to embrace, tears run down your face
I whisper words of love so softly
I can't believe this pain, it's driving me insane
Without your love life will be lonely”
They had spent the night wrapped in each other’s
arms, making love. Tallia knew she was
going to miss him, but she knew that she would be
joining him soon.

“Morning has come, another day
I must pack my bags and say goodbye...”

The next day, Tallia drove JC to meet the other guys.
He had wrapped her in his arms and
kissed her. He told her he would be seeing her in a
few weeks.
She had tried not to let her tears show, but she
already missed him. She whispered, “I love
you.”
He had held her tight and told her, “It won’t be long
until we are together. I love you, too.”
He hadn’t known that would be the last time he would
kiss her. He got on the tour bus, and
waved to her. As he watched her form disappearing
from sight, he seen an awful sight unfolding
in front of him. She was standing on the sidewalk,
still waving to him. She didn’t see the pickup
that had lost control and was headed straight for her.
“Noooooo!” JC yelled. It happened as if it
was in slow motion. The pickup struck her. He saw
her body flying through the air, then landing.
He ran to the front of the bus, “Stop the bus!”
The bus driver stopped and JC flew off the bus to
Tallia’s side. “My God, Tallia,” he moaned.
He held her unmoving body. “I love you! Don’t you
leave me!” he kept repeating. He heard
sirens in the background.
“Sir, you’re gonna have to let go of her,” a
paramedic said.
“No! Leave her alone,” he said, hugging her.
“JC, you have to let her go. They’re trying to help
her,” Lance said. He pulled JC away from
Tallia. JC got up slowly and watched as they put her
in an ambulance. He got in with her and
rode to the hospital. When they arrived at the
hospital, Tallia was taken away to surgery right
away.
After a few hours, a doctor had come out, “I’m sorry
Mr. Chasez, we lost your fiance.” JC
had sat down, stunned. He didn’t hear what the rest
of what the doctor was saying to him.

So raise your hands to heaven and pray
That we'll be back together someday
Tonight, I need your sweet caress
Hold me in the darkness
Tonight, you calm my restlessness
You relieve my sadness

JC sat down, on the wet ground, beside her grave. He
gently laid the lilacs, her favorite
flower, on her grave. It had been four years, but he
missed her like it was yesterday. He felt
someone tug on his sleeve. He looked down.
“Daddy? Is Mommy here?” a beautiful little girl
asked. She was the spitting image of her
mom. She had vivid hazel eyes and a beautiful face.
It almost hurt to look at her, because she
looked so much like her mom. Tallia had been 8 months
pregnant when the pickup hit and killed
her. Only by a miracle, were the doctors able to save
his little girl.
“Yes, honey,” JC said. “Go ahead and say hi to her.”
“Hi Mommy. I love you!” JC watched as his little
girl talked to her mom. He felt tears slide
down his cheeks. Adaira had never met her mommy, but
JC was constantly talking about her. So
she knew all about her mom. “I’m big now. I wish you
were here, but Daddy says you are
helping God. He said we’ll be together someday.”
“I love you, Tallia. I miss you so much. Adaira is
growing up so fast. She’s so smart. She
already has your sense of humor. I thank you everyday
for Adaira, without her, I don’t know
how I would have gone on. We love you,” JC said. He
knew she was there, listening to him. He
came here every year on her birthday and Adaira’s. JC
walked over to where Adaira was standing
and took her hand.

From a distance, Tallia watched as the man she loved
walked away from her grave. She
wanted so much to hold him again, but knew that he had
a long life ahead of him. She listened as
the music still played. She couldn’t wait until the
day they would finally be together again.

So raise your hands to heaven and pray
That we'll be back together someday
Tonight, I need your sweet caress
Hold me in the darkness
Tonight, you calm my restlessness
You relieve my sadness
